Lighting Effects1-

2-

3-

Chiaroscuro has been used here to connote a tense, negative and powerful atmosphere around the character standing in the image. It also creates depth in this particular scene. When looking at the light behind the character and how it makes his shadow look enormous, we as the audience denote that this character is dangerous.

In ‘Sin City’ low key lighting has been used to create dramatic effects and it is mostly associated with horror films or film noir. The use of it in ‘Sin city’ is that it creates suspense , eeriness and even seclusion at most part. The director chose not to use low-key lighting for everything e.g. blood, objects and symbols had their natural colour. This could have been done to add to the dramatic effect in a fight scene or to focus our attention to an object/subject.

Some movies use high key-lighting, this is used to make the scene appear very bright and soft. ‘The Wizard of Oz’ (1939) used high key-lighting, this scene looks unrealistic as we don’t have light this bright in real life. This denotes that this movie is also unrealistic and so making us think that it can be a fantasy. Comparing this to low key-lighting it is the opposite and doesn’t add a dramatic effect.
